How Wrestling Card Values Are Determined

Determining value hinges on many aspects: card condition assessed by grading companies, including centering, corners, edges, and surface quality; rarity and wrestler popularity; autograph verification; serial numbering; and how recently similar cards have sold in the marketplace. Each factor contributes to a dynamic valuation process in Waterloo’s active community.

Tips Before Buying Wrestling Cards in Waterloo

  • Check recent sales records for price guidance.
  • Understand grading schemes and card conditions that influence value.
  • Look closely at cards to identify potential wear or damage.
  • Differentiating vintage from contemporary cards helps in assessing worth and rarity.
  • Compare prices among local shops and online platforms.
  • Use protective sleeves and cases to safeguard valuable collectibles.
  • Stay aware of shifting interests within the wrestling collecting community.

Popular Wrestling Card Products Collectors Look For in Waterloo

Collectors seek Panini WWE Prizm and Panini Select series, Topps autograph and relic cards, graded rookie cards, and sealed hobby boxes. Complete sets and specialty inserts highlight many collections, reflecting both nostalgia and current production quality.
